As someone who enjoys discovering local eateries, my recent visit to Go Farm in Nairobi was nothing short of delightful. I arrived at around 2 PM on a Saturday, ready to indulge in their offerings. The atmosphere inside was a perfect blend of warmth and vibrancy, making it an inviting spot to unwind after a busy week.

One of the standout features of Go Farm is its commitment to sourcing fresh ingredients, and this was evident as soon as I glanced at the menu. I decided to try their signature dish, the Farm Fresh Salad, which is priced at a reasonable KSh 350. This salad is a colorful medley of leafy greens, cherry tomatoes, cucumbers, and their special house dressing. It was incredibly refreshing and served as an ideal start to my meal. The freshness of the vegetables truly showcased why Go Farm has garnered such positive reviews for their food quality.

While savoring my salad, I had the pleasure of being served by Michael, one of the attendants who was exceptionally attentive and friendly. His recommendations made the experience even better, especially when I asked about their main courses.

Following the salad, I opted for the Grilled Herb Chicken, priced at KSh 800. It was marinated to perfection, giving it a delightful flavor that married well with the smoky grilled taste. As I dug in, I couldn’t help but appreciate how well-prepared the dish was. The portion size was generous, making it worth every shilling.

Dessert was an easy choice after such a fulfilling meal. I ordered the Chocolate Lava Cake, available for KSh 500. Devouring this delightful treat, I was met with a soft center of molten chocolate that was to die for. With a scoop of vanilla ice cream on the side, it was the perfect end to my culinary journey at Go Farm.
